Webb12 aug. 2024 · Someone recently found this site by searching the string: “Meaning of ‘Shabbat Shalom.'”. “Shabbat shalom” is a Hebrew greeting for the Jewish Sabbath. Its literal meaning is “Sabbath of Peace.”. Shabbat [the Sabbath] officially begins at sundown Friday and continues to sundown Saturday. Webb22 aug. 2024 · Shalom שָׁלוֹם is the Hebrew noun derived from the 3-letter Verb root Shalam שָׁלַם. It is defined as Completeness, Soundness, Wholeness, Welfare, Peace, Function, Fullness, Health, Safety, Security, Tranquility, to Restore, to Repay, to Reward, to Make Amends, to Make Restitution, to Make Good…in other words, it is the absence of chaos. Commonly translated as “peace” and used as both a greeting and farewell, shalom has rich meaning in Hebrew. “Peace” is an accurate translation of the term, but shalom implies more than lack of conflict. According to Strong’s Exhaustive Concordance, shalom means “completeness, soundness, welfare, peace.”.
